Investigation continues into Willingboro death; SWAT team visits scene

WILLINGBORO, Pa. (KYW Newsradio) — Police in South Jersey are looking for a woman's killer. Authorities say the victim was shot dead in a car in Willingboro. 

Police say 21-year-old Maribely Lopez was discovered around 8:30 a.m. Thursday in a running car on Medley Lane, in a neighborbood close to Beverly Rancocas Road. She had been shot and killed.


.@WillingboroPD and the @BurlcoPros are investigating the death of Maribely Lopez, 21. Police say they found Lopez shot to death in her car yesterday morning. So far no arrests in the case. @KYWNewsradio

Thursday night, the SWAT team returned to the neighborhood where she was. Sources told CBS 3 Eyewitness News they were searching a home that's connected to the Lopez's death.

Lopez is from Lindenwold, which is about a half-hour away from the scene. It's not really clear why she was in Willingboro. 

Neighbor Evonne Hudson says she saw the red car Lopez was in. She said she didn't think anything of it.

"I drive to work every morning. I see people warming up their cars and stuff so that's what I thought was going on," she said. "I didn't think nothing. I didn't see no bullet holes in the car or anything like that."

Willingboro Police and the Burlington County Prosecutor's Office are on the case. They're asking anyone with any useful information to let get in touch.
